The name Hawal is of Arabic origin, meaning 'message' or 'trust.' It is often associated with concepts of communication and the importance of delivering trustworthy information. Historically, it relates to the Arabic root 'ḥ-w-l,' which connotes transfer or conveyance, commonly used in traditional contexts of trust and exchange in Middle Eastern cultures.

Cultural Significance of Hawal

In Middle Eastern and Arabic-speaking cultures, the name Hawal symbolizes trustworthiness and the sacred duty of conveying messages accurately. Historically, messengers or trusted intermediaries were vital in tribal and community relations, making the name a reflection of reliability and honor. Its use has been closely tied to values of faith and honesty that remain central in these cultures.

Hawal Name Popularity in 2025

Today, Hawal is a distinctive name that remains relatively uncommon globally but is appreciated for its deep cultural roots and meaningful connotation. It appeals to parents seeking a name that is unique yet rich in heritage. The name fits well in multicultural settings and is gaining subtle popularity among diaspora communities valuing Arabic linguistic heritage.
